The Extraction Process

The process begins by selecting high-quality cannabis flowers from original Indica or Sativa strains. These are then subjected to one of several extraction methods, such as CO₂ extraction, ethanol extraction, or cold-press techniques. These methods separate the plant's beneficial compounds—primarily cannabinoids and terpenes—from the raw plant material. The result is a potent oil that can be refined or blended depending on the therapeutic use.

Full-Spectrum vs. Broad-Spectrum vs. Isolate

Medicinal cannabis oils are typically categorised into three types based on their cannabinoid content:

  • Full-Spectrum Oils: These oils contain all cannabinoids, including trace amounts of THC, CBD, CBN, CBG, and the original strain's terpene profile. This type offers the "entourage effect," where all compounds work synergistically for enhanced benefits.
  • Broad-Spectrum Oils: Similar to full-spectrum but with THC completely removed, making them ideal for users who want therapeutic effects without any psychoactive impact.
  • Isolate Oils: Contain only one isolated compound, most commonly CBD. These are highly purified and ideal for those who need targeted treatment without interaction from other cannabinoids.

Epilepsy and Seizure Control

CBD-dominant oils have gained global attention for their capacity to dramatically lower seizure frequency and severity, especially in treatment-resistant forms of epilepsy such as Dravet syndrome and Lennox-Gastaut syndrome. These oils are typically non-psychoactive, making them suitable for children and adults seeking natural seizure control without a high.
